thin-sown
thin-sown, a. (θɪnsəʊn: stress var.) Also 7 thin-sowed. Sown or planted thinly; lit. said of plants, or a crop; fig. scattered at wide intervals, scarce; also, of a field or territory: scantily furnished with († of).1589 R. Harvey Pl. Perc. (1590) 18 Good deeds, which are now both thin sowne.., and ...
